What Exactly is a Color by Number Potential/Kinetic Energy Answer Key?

A color by number potential/kinetic energy answer key is essentially a worksheet designed to teach students about the principles of energy through coloring activities. Each section of the worksheet corresponds to a specific color based on the answers students calculate using physics formulas. It's like solving a puzzle where each piece represents a concept in motion and rest energy.

For example, if a question asks you to calculate the kinetic energy of a moving object, you'd use the formula KE = 0.5mv² (where m is mass and v is velocity). Once you solve it, you match your answer to the corresponding color and shade the designated area. Simple, right? But here's the kicker—it’s not just simple; it’s engaging!

How Do You Use a Color by Number Potential/Kinetic Energy Answer Key?

Using a color by number potential/kinetic energy answer key is pretty straightforward. Here's a step-by-step guide:

  1. Start by reviewing the instructions carefully. Make sure you understand what each color corresponds to.
  2. Work through the problems one at a time. For instance, if a question asks you to calculate the potential energy of an object, use the formula PE = mgh (where m is mass, g is gravity, and h is height).
  3. Match your calculated answer to the provided key and color the corresponding section.
  4. Once all sections are filled, you'll reveal a hidden picture or pattern.

The Science Behind Potential and Kinetic Energy

Before we dive deeper into the world of color by number worksheets, let's revisit the basics of potential and kinetic energy. Understanding these concepts is crucial for making the most out of the answer keys.

Potential energy refers to stored energy—an object has potential energy due to its position or state. Think of a stretched rubber band or a book sitting on a shelf. On the other hand, kinetic energy is the energy of motion. When that rubber band snaps back or the book falls off the shelf, its potential energy converts into kinetic energy.

Key Formulas to Know

Here are the two fundamental formulas you'll encounter when working with color by number potential/kinetic energy answer keys:

  • Potential Energy (PE): PE = mgh
  • Kinetic Energy (KE): KE = 0.5mv²

Where:

  • m = mass (in kilograms)
  • g = acceleration due to gravity (approximately 9.8 m/s²)
  • h = height (in meters)
  • v = velocity (in meters per second)
